Автоматизований тестер видимості SEO та Google Ads (Playwright + Docker)
Я шукаю розробника для створення автоматизованого інструменту, який перевіряє, наскільки видимі певні вебсайти в Google Search та Google Ads. Він повинен працювати через Firefox за допомогою Playwright і бути контейнеризованим за допомогою Docker для підтримки кількох паралельних сесій.
Щоб було зрозуміло – це не клік-бот. Інструмент повинен поводитися як реальний користувач. Він увійде в тестовий обліковий запис Google, шукатиме конкретні ключові слова, прокрутить результати (органічні та спонсоровані) і натисне на визначені посилання. Потрапивши на цільовий сайт, він повинен поводитися природно – не просто відскакувати. Якщо він не імітує справжню поведінку користувача, його заблокують або позначать, що зводить нанівець всю ідею.
Мета полягає в тестуванні видимості в різних регіонах, тому підтримка ротаційних проксі та геолокації є обов'язковою.
➡ Що потрібно зробити:
- Працювати в безголовому або видимому (налагоджувальному) режимі
- Використовувати проксі з геолокацією (ротаційні IP-адреси, різні регіони)
- Завантажити модуль Cookie Robot (відкривати попередньо задані сайти, приймати куки, імітувати історію)
- Увійти в тестовий обліковий запис Google (дані для входу надаються)
- Шукати в Google конкретні фрази
- Сканувати певну кількість сторінок результатів (наприклад, 4, 6 або 8)
- Натиснути на визначене посилання (органічне або рекламне)
- Імітувати реалістичну поведінку в SERP та на цільовому сайті
- Зберігати повний журнал кожної сесії (TXT або JSON)
- Працювати на Linux VPS
- Дозволяти кільком агентам працювати паралельно
✅ Технології, до яких ми прагнемо:
- Playwright (Python) + Firefox
- Docker (кожен агент у окремому контейнері)
- Обробка проксі з авторизацією та виявленням місцезнаходження
- Перевірка геолокації (наприклад, IPInfo API)
- Налаштування через JSON або YAML
- Модульна структура коду (модуль куків, вхід, пошук, взаємодія, ведення журналу)
- Ведення журналу сесій (TXT або JSON)
✳Бажано мати:
- Просту панель для перегляду журналів (FastAPI + React/Vue)
- Ведення журналу в базі даних (MongoDB або SQLite)
- Інтеграція з проксі-сервісами (Node Maven, Bright Data, SmartProxy тощо)
Дата початку - якнайшвидше. Це повністю віддалений проект, і я відкритий до фіксованої ціни або оплати за етапами – що б найкраще підходило. Також є потенціал для подальшої роботи, наприклад, панелі або масштабування системи. В ідеалі я шукаю когось, хто вже робив подібну автоматизацію браузера. Я сам не розробник, тому не соромтеся ставити запитання – мені просто потрібен хтось, хто може допомогти зробити це так, як потрібно.
-
10 днів51 941 UAH
516 10 3 10 днів51 941 UAHПривіт!
Готовий виконати для вас розробку цього інструмента.
У мене є досвід роботи з Playwright, Docker та проксі-інтеграціями. Розумію, що ключове тут — реалістична поведінка користувача, інакше Google швидко помітить автоматизацію. Це буде враховано.
Готовий розпочати роботу найближчим часом.
-
10 днів62 330 UAH
847 14 0 10 днів62 330 UAHПривіт, Фінн!
У мене є досвід створення автоматизованих інструментів, де ключовим є імітація реальної поведінки користувача, а не просто виконання скриптів (в даний час працюю з Google Search та YouTube).
У своїх попередніх проектах я працював з:
- Playwright (Python) та Selenium — автоматизація браузера, включаючи безголовий режим на Linux VPS (Ubuntu 20.04–24.04);
- Docker — ізоляція агентів у контейнерах та запуск кількох сесій паралельно;
- проксі з аутентифікацією та геолокацією (інтеграція з зовнішніми сервісами, кастомний перемикач проксі для 3G модемів та перевірка проксі);
- модульна архітектура — окремі компоненти для входу, взаємодії з браузером/сайтом, імітації куків та ведення журналу; досвід роботи з системами на основі мікросервісів;
… - детальне ведення журналу у форматах JSON/TXT та базах даних у зручному форматі для подальшого аналізу.
У мене також є практичний досвід з FastAPI (легкі сервіси RestAPI) та React (панелі моніторингу та клієнтські інтерфейси), що може бути цінним на пізнішій стадії проекту — для перегляду журналів та управління агентами.
Для завдань такого типу я знаю, що найважливішим фактором є природна поведінка користувача: реалістичні паузи, прокручування, затримки перед кліками та взаємодія з кількома елементами сторінки.
З архітектурної точки зору я пропоную розділити проект на модулі (куки, вхід, пошук, взаємодія, ведення журналу), щоб розробляти та тестувати їх крок за кроком. Інтерфейс моніторингу може бути реалізований або як спільна панель для всіх контейнерів, або окремо для кожного контейнера, залежно від ваших пріоритетів.
Я відкритий до обговорення деталей і врахую ваші вимоги. Я надав приблизний графік і бюджет, ми можемо уточнити це для кожного модуля в міру просування, щоб проект ефективно відповідав вашим пріоритетам.
З найкращими побажаннями,
Ерік Соколов
-
hello , sorry i was way
-
do you have a moment ?
-
Актуальні фриланс-проєкти в категорії Python
Telegram bot для найму/пошуку працівників. Для пошуку роботи
1100 UAH
1. Загальна концепція Створення Telegram-бота для автоматизації підбору персоналу та двостороннього пошуку роботи. Система працює за принципом активного відгуку та взаємного підтвердження інтересу (Double Opt-In). У системі передбачено дві ролі: Роботодавець (Власник фірми) та… Python, Розробка ботів ∙ 23 години 46 хвилин тому ∙ 82 ставки |
Технічна підтримка веб-платформи (Python/Django)Є працюючий веб-проект, потрібно підтримувати і поступово приводити в порядок, без переписування з нуля. Стек проекту: Backend: Python, Django, Django Rest Framework Frontend: Next.js База даних: PostgreSQL Інфраструктура: AWS (EC2), Nginx Є інтеграції з зовнішніми API… Python, Веб-програмування ∙ 1 день 1 година тому ∙ 67 ставок |
Розробка веб-сервісу з платним доступом до онлайн-чатуДоброго дня, необхідно розробити веб-сервіс, який включає: * персональні посилання для користувачів; * сторінку з описом послуги; * оплату через PayPal; * онлайн-чат в реальному часі; * відображення відео на сторінці користувача; * облік оплаченного часу та автоматичне… Python, Веб-програмування ∙ 2 дні 3 години тому ∙ 74 ставки |
Створення додаткуБажаю створити мобільний додаток для спілкування, в застосунку має бути аудіо,відео дзвінок, створення групових чатів,можливість синхронізувати з контактами телефону, налаштуваннями акаунта: привязка по мейлу, 2фа, номеру телефону,можливість налаштовувати сповіщення… Java, Python ∙ 3 дні тому ∙ 36 ставок |
Налаштування двосторонньої інтеграції WhatsApp з Odoo CRMВітаю! Шукаємо спеціаліста для реалізації технічного завдання з налаштування двосторонньої інтеграції месенджера WhatsApp з CRM-системою Odoo. ⚠️ Важливе технічне уточнення:Офіційний WhatsApp Business API (WABA) не розглядається. Необхідно впровадити стабільне «сіре» рішення… Python, Веб-програмування ∙ 3 дні 10 годин тому ∙ 24 ставки |